Rare Hardy "The Barton" Dry Fly Reel

[ translate ]

A rare "natural finish" example, made without the leaded finish found on most of the 109 reels produced from 1934 to 1939 (production numbers as published in John Drewett's book Hardy Brothers - The Masters, The Men and Their Reels). Clearly marked on the tail plate of this 3 1/4" diameter frame reel "The Barton Dry Fly Reel", an Ex condition example with original off-set, ribbed brass foot, four-screw line guide attached to the frame (right hand-wind only) and three-screw aluminum spool latch. Another detail of the Barton reels is the reverse taper grasp, original on this example as well. Finished with a nickel silver tension screw on the rim, a fine reel for even an advanced Hardy collection.
